Comparative profiling of the synaptic proteome from Alzheimer’s disease patients with focus on the APOE genotype

2019-05-08

Abstract excerpt

Degeneration of synapses in Alzheimer’s disease (AD) strongly correlates with cognitive decline, and synaptic pathology contributes to disease pathophysiology. We recently discovered that the strongest genetic risk factor for sporadic AD, apolipoprotein E epsilon 4 ( APOE 4), exacerbates synapse loss and synaptic accumulation of oligomeric amyloid beta in human AD brain.
